6个可以隐藏运行bat,浏览器等程序的方法

标签: 软件技巧 HideRun 后台执行批处理 后台运行 浏览器 | 发表时间:2012-06-07 14:32 | 作者:Luckerme
出处:http://luckerme.com

在电脑启动时或者设置时间时运行指定的程序很容易实现。但是有时候还需要运行时不显示主界面,隐藏到后台运行。比如:开机时一段Bat批处理执行删除默认共享; 开机自动运行浏览器隐藏到后代打开指定网页等,希望所有的操作对用户都是不可见的。如果你也有这样的需求,这里我收集了几个让批处理、浏览器等程序隐藏到运行的方法或许可以帮到你。

  • 方法一: HideRun.vbs脚本文件
代码:CreateObject("WScript.Shell").Run "cmd /c D:test.bat",0


把以上代码复制到文本文件中,保存为.vbs文件(比如 HideRun.vbs),其中 D:test.bat 为你要运行的批处理文件,下同。

  • 方法二: HideRun.bat批处理文件

代码:

echo CreateObject("WScript.Shell").Run "cmd /c D:test.bat",0>$tmp.vbs
cscript.exe /e:vbscript $tmp.vbs
del $tmp.vbs

或者:

mshta vbscript:CreateObject("WScript.Shell").Run("iexplore http://luckerme.com",0)(window.close)


以上代码选一个复制到文本文件中,修改自定义的内容保存为.bat文件(比如 HideRun.bat)。

  • 方法三: HideRun.js文件

代码:

new ActiveXObject('WScript.Shell').Run('cmd /c D:Test.bat',0);


把以上代码复制到文本文件中,保存为.js文件(比如 HideRun.js)。Javascript的字符串变量可以用单引号,从而方便命令行作为参数调用,而且js很好的支持多行语句用 ; 分隔写成一行。要注意的是:js要区分大小写,方法必须用括号,结尾必须有分号。所以写成命令行就是:

mshta "javascript:new ActiveXObject('WScript.Shell').Run('cmd
/c D:test.bat',0);window.close()"
  • 方法四: 使用系统服务

代码:

runassrv add /cmdline:"C:WindowsSystem32cmd.exe /c D:test.bat"  /name:"myservicesname"
net start myservicesname


可以用sc建立一个系统服务然后启动这个服务来启动批处理。缺点是启动服务较慢,需要管理员权限。

  • 方法五: 使用at计划任务

代码:

at 09:00 "cmd /c D:Test.bat"


用at可以建立一个计划任务,在不输入 /interactive 参数可以后台运行。使用at必须有管理员权限。然后在系统就会自动后台以SYSTEM权限运行这个bat。

  • 方法六:使用第三方软件

今天搜索时找到了一款名为HOU任务计划(OnTimer.exe)的定时/循环执行任务的绿色小软件。软件虽小,功能很大。可以用来定时执行程序、DOS命令、从HTTP服务器下载程序运行、结束进程、模拟按键、发送EMAIL、网络唤醒、消息提示、关机、重启、注销、锁定、待机等操作。其中普通运行、参数运行、 执行DOS “备注”开头为“-h”则隐藏执行,即可满足我们的需求。相信的介绍及下载可以到软件的官方页面: http://www.yryz.net/soft-OnTimer.htm

上边五种方法简单方便,都是系统的功能,无需额外的软件。但是,自己创建的bat,vbs文件可能会被杀毒软件误报误删,所有设置好后最好手动加入到杀毒软件的信任列表。目前我使用的是最后一种方法,借助OnTimer.exe这个小软件,配置方便。而且,加入启动项后,360检查开机项目时不会提示禁止,在系统检查修复界面也不会检测到非安全项。其他杀软未测试。你可以都测试下,采用适合的方法实现隐藏运行程序的功能。

搜索以下内容到本文:

  • 程序运行不显示
  • 计划任务 bat 后台执行

您可能也喜欢:

WordPress优化设置浏览器端缓存:Leverage browser caching

小技巧-把任意文件隐藏在图片中

3个隐藏WordPress指定分类文章的插件

3个检测浏览器User-Agent信息的网站

收集几个移动平台浏览器的User-Agent
来自无觅网络的相关文章:

『手机』Go浏览器——超炫时尚的3G时代手机浏览器 (@honghublog)

百度手机浏览器-垃圾中的战斗机 (@citydog)

AirDroid – 用浏览器+Wifi来管理Android (@citydog)

Win7″本地打印后台处理程序服务没有运行”的解决办法 (@libing)

LastPass-网络密码管家 (@citydog)
无觅

相关 [bat 浏览器 程序] 推荐:

6个可以隐藏运行bat,浏览器等程序的方法

- - LuckerMe.com
在电脑启动时或者设置时间时运行指定的程序很容易实现. 但是有时候还需要运行时不显示主界面,隐藏到后台运行. 比如:开机时一段Bat批处理执行删除默认共享; 开机自动运行浏览器隐藏到后代打开指定网页等,希望所有的操作对用户都是不可见的. 如果你也有这样的需求,这里我收集了几个让批处理、浏览器等程序隐藏到运行的方法或许可以帮到你.

Chrome浏览器发布远程控制电脑扩展程序

- -_- - YesKafei Daily
浏览器在互联网中扮演的角色越来越重. Google很早就看到了浏览器的重要性,Google Chrome就好像一部单反,具备卡片欠缺的更多操控性和扩展性. 10月7日,Google推出Chrome扩展程序:Chrome Remote Desktop,实现了通过浏览器就可以远程控制计算机的功能. 目前软件属于测试阶段,支持Windows, Linux, Mac和Chromebooks系统.

javaScript跨浏览器事件处理程序

- - SegmentFault 最新的文章
最近在阅读 javascript高级程序设计,事件这一块还是有很多东西要学的,就把一些思考和总结记录下. 在事件处理,事件对象,阻止事件的传播等方法或对象存在着浏览器兼容性问题,开发过程中最好编写成一个通用的事件处理工具. //在这里添加一些通用的事件处理方法. 事件的绑定主要为IE8以下浏览器做兼容处理:.

BAT的电商江湖

- 果 - It Talks-魏武挥的blog
大部分数字产业中人都认同,BAT代表的是中国商业江湖中超一流数字公司. B(Baidu,百度)做的是资讯的渠道,A(Alibaba,阿里)做的是商务的渠道,T(Tecent,腾讯)做的是交流的渠道. 而在BAT中,我以为,B和A的模式是类似的. 与腾讯一门心思兜售各种虚拟产品给用户不同(腾讯的用户即它的客户),百度和阿里都是靠帮助别人发财从而自己发财的公司.

Node.js 的发明者将Javascript程序拓展到浏览器之外

- - 译言-电脑/网络/数码科技
Node.js 的发明者将Javascript程序拓展到浏览器之外 采访: Ryan Dahl 解释为什么他的发明能够让开发者着迷. 三年前的下个月,Joyent的软件工程师 Ryan Dahl 开发了Node.js 这个开源项目. 他使得Javascript能够运行于浏览器之外. Node使用Google的V8 Javascript虚拟机来解释Javascript,使用Joyent云服务提供商提供的由事件驱动的无阻塞I/O模型,这是Node提倡的一个原则--它能够有效的用分布式设备来处理数据密集的实时应用.

BAT如何抢食“to B”新蛋糕

- - 机器之心
在兴奋与焦虑杂糅交错下,“下半场”正在成为传统互联网圈的核心话题. 传统互联网的上半场只是一场关于“消费互联网”的竞争,C(即Costumer,消费者)端的个人用户是巨头们争夺的核心目标,他们希望把每个人的生活线上化、数据化. 于是,人们开始用手机买机票、打车、订酒店、聊天、购物、看新闻……而BATJTMD等公司一跃成为巨头公司.

微软杀毒软件 MSE 报 Chrome 浏览器为“密码窃取程序”,建议删除

- applelen - 谷奥——探寻谷歌的奥秘
感谢读者 cosery 的爆料. 病毒定义版本1.113.656.0的Microsoft Security Essentials突然提示Google Chrome浏览器主程序包含“密码窃取程序”,默认操作为自动删除. 即便是从Google官网下载最新版浏览器仍然报病毒. 而早先的病毒定义版本1.113.599.0的MSE下Google Chrome运行正常.

[程序员] 如果你用 chrome 浏览器,而碰巧又用 Google 搜索的话,那么请进

- - V2EX
据说:在 Chrome 浏览器中打开「实验性功能」页面(chrome://flags/),启用「实验性 QUIC 协议」和「经由实验性 QUIC 协议发出的 HTTPS 请求」,重启浏览器后可以正常登陆 Google 相关服务. 经过实践,可以打开Google搜索了.

记毕业时求职BAT产品经理的经验

- - 人人都是产品经理
   遥想当年还是对于产品经理一无所知的XX青年,在回忆起当年的面试经历,确实有很多值得反思的地方,最终的失利也是很正常的,这里分享出来,供马上要求职产品经理的孩子们参考吧. 腾讯的招聘的职位没有分的很细,基本上就是技术与非技术两种,需要他们自己做的网申系统投递简历,网申也十分简单(做的十分粗糙,不敢想是中国最牛互联网公司做出来的系统),基本上10分钟就搞定了.

BAT金融大数据体系拆解与价值挖掘

- - 虎嗅网
金融创新很大一部分原因在于大数据和金融之间的结合. 纵观BAT、京东、小米、万达、平安这些把触角伸到互联网金融领域的巨头,无一不是在大数据层面上有所布局. 大数据和金融相结合,几乎已经成为金融领域的通用做法. 谈数据必须先谈数据的完整度和价值含量. 就像煤矿一样,大数据中的价值含量、挖掘成本比数量更为重要.